At the "Lo Co" fan meeting, Phuong My Chi surprised her fans by revealing the first early demo version of "Bong Phu Hoa". Few people know that, before becoming a musical "phenomenon", this song once had a completely different appearance.
The demo "There is peace" and soldier-inspired
In the cozy atmosphere of a fan appreciation event, Phuong My Chi shared about the most important milestone in her album "The Crane's Flight Universe." The singer surprised everyone by announcing the first demo track titled "There's Peace."
In this early version, the song's content focuses on the image of a young man bidding farewell to his homeland to enlist in the army. With its slow, simple melody and deeply folk-like, narrative lyrics, "There Is Peace" portrays silent sacrifice and intense homesickness. However, despite its sincere emotions and meaningful patriotic spirit, this draft remains stuck in familiar values and fails to create a strong artistic breakthrough.
A bold "pivot": When medieval literature takes center stage
The turning point came when Phuong My Chi and her team decided to conduct a groundbreaking experiment: completely changing the approach to the work. The singer decided to make a 180-degree turn, replacing the image of the soldier with the character Vu Nuong from the classic work "The Story of the Girl from Nam Xuong".
From this point, "Fleeting Shadows" was officially born, completely replacing "There Is Peace." This shift was not only in the title but also changed the entire musical ideology: the song shifted to depicting the injustice, the fragile fate, and the tragedy of women in the old society. The language became more refined with multiple layers of metaphorical meaning, imbued with classical and philosophical depth. The musical treatment became more subtle, enchanting, and haunting, creating an artistic space that was both ancient and modern.
Resounding success and international impact.
The facts have proven Phuong My Chi's foresight to be completely accurate. "Bong Phu Hoa" not only became the soul of the album "Vu Tru Co Bay" but also a national hit that elevated her name to a new level.
In particular, at the Sing! Asia 2025 stage, "Bóng phù hoa" (Ephemeral Shadow) created a real sensation. Phuong My Chi's stunning performance not only captivated domestic audiences but also impressed international friends with the beauty of Vietnamese culture through modern music. The song became clear evidence of the mature artistic thinking and the desire to honor national values of this Gen Z female singer.
The behind-the-scenes story of "Bóng phù hoa" (Fleeting Shadows) is proof that art sometimes requires drastic decisions and last-minute changes. For Phương Mỹ Chi, the courage to abandon a safe demo in pursuit of a culturally profound idea created a brilliant milestone in her career.
